Output 586f68c53c9b837296e12a0a3917bfb680c78619cfdf9018b956bd5e654f9bbe:37

value
12690352
script pubkey
OP_0 OP_PUSHBYTES_20 83be9a343e7e41557119feab0d7ba823a155d37d
address
bc1qswlf5dp70eq42ugel64s67agyws4t5ma5z0qhc
transaction
586f68c53c9b837296e12a0a3917bfb680c78619cfdf9018b956bd5e654f9bbe